RC (Roman Catholic) Chaplain

Job Introduction

Sodexo Justice Services has been operating in the United Kingdom since 1993. We operate five prisons in the UK and have a reputation for operating excellent, ethical, innovative and rehabilitative services. Our vision is to become a strategic partner of our clients by designing, managing and delivering quality of life services which make a meaningful difference to offenders by changing lives for the better.

HMP Northumberland is the newest addition to the SJS estate.  Our aim is to introduce the technology and initiatives that have been so successful in our other prisons whilst providing real work opportunities for prisoners which match those available in the community.

As Part Time RC Chaplain, you will provide pastoral needs for prisoners whatever their religion.

You will maintain and develop links with visiting Ministers from other faiths and with faith communities to develop support for reintegration, providing counselling when appropriate for prisoners and staff.

Role Responsibility

  • Serve the needs of prisoners and staff by supporting religious faith and practice within the prison.
  • Work together to create an ordered and caring community where individuals can discover and practice their religion and develop and strengthen appropriate links with their family and faith communities.
  • Support prisoners of all faiths through facilitating religious prayers and teachings of Faiths representative of the prisoner population.
  • To participate in the Equality and Inclusion Management Team meetings.
  • To take on when necessary and appropriate generic chaplaincy duties including applications, new receptions, visiting prisoners in Separation and Care and in Healthcare centre.
  • Represent the prison and company to the local community.
  • Encourage the faith community outside the prison to take an active interest in the rehabilitation of prisoners.
  • Help prisoners prepare for release.
  • Provide pastoral support to staff and co-ordinate a Post Incident Care Team providing training as necessary.
  • Work with other chaplains recognising and respecting the integrity of other faiths and promoting peace and co-operation.

Package Description

£15,000 - £17,000 per annum

24 hours per week with some weekend and evening work required.

Applications will be accepted from Priests or Deacons. Lay Roman Catholics may also apply, as long as they are endorsed by the Roman Catholic Church and have the necessary qualifications to lead Services of the Word
